How to Change Lock Screen Toggles on Your iPhone

Step 1: Access Your Lock Screen Customization Settings

Begin by long-pressing your lock screen until the customization options appear. Select Customize followed by Lock Screen.

Pro Tip: Ensure you are running the latest developer beta of iOS 18 to access these features.

Step 2: Remove Existing Shortcuts

To eliminate current toggles, tap the icon adjacent to each toggle. Once removed, click the + icon to add new toggles.

Step 3: Choose Your New Toggle Options

Browse through various options available for your lock screen and select the desired toggle to incorporate.

Step 4: Confirm Your Selection and Save

After making your selection, tap Done to confirm your changes. Your lock screen toggles are now successfully customized.

Step 5: Customize Different Toggles for Various Lock Screens

You can configure distinct toggles for different lock screens, aligning with your personal or professional activities.

Pro Tip: Personalizing toggles for various profiles can be extremely beneficial for quickly accessing relevant apps.

Note: If you choose to delete toggles without adding replacements, the shortcuts will vanish entirely, allowing for a cleaner appearance on your lock screen.

Additionally, the ‘Open App’ feature lets you assign any app as a shortcut on your lock screen. Here’s how you can set this up:

Step 6: Access ‘Open App’ Settings

Repeat the first two steps to navigate back to lock screen customization. In the control selection area, tap on Open App, then choose Choose to select your preferred app.

Step 7: Finalize Your App Selection

Select the app you wish to add and tap anywhere on the screen to close the app selection menu. Ensure your chosen app is now set as a toggle.

Step 8: Confirm and Add the App Toggle

Tap Done in the upper right corner to confirm your selection. The app will now appear on your lock screen as a toggle.
